We are looking to recruit an Outpatient Clerk/Receptionist to work in the Main Outpatients of this busy teaching hospital.This post will be located at either Wythenshawe, Withington, Trafford, Altrincham Hospital. This will be confirmed at interview.The successful candidates will join a well established, friendly team, committed to providing a quality service to our patients.   • Registering referrals
  • ASI lists
  • Validating
  • Phone enquires
  • Rebooking / rescheduling patients
  • Work queues
  • Phoning patients with appts at short notice if required
  • Phoning patients and cancelling appts at short notice
  • Requesting notes for the next day’s clinic
  • Updating patient demographics/data input
  • Training
  • Reception cover in multiple areas within OPD
  • Any other admin duties

About usMFT is one of the largest NHS Trusts in England with a turnover of £2.8bn & is on a different scale than most other NHS Trusts. We’re creating an exceptional integrated health & social care system for the 1 million patients who rely on our services every year.Bringing together 10 hospitals & community services from across Manchester, Trafford & beyond, we champion collaborative working & transformation, encouraging our 30,000 workforce to pursue their most ambitious goals. We set standards that other Trusts seek to emulate so you’ll benefit from a scale of opportunity that is nothing short of extraordinary.We’ve also created a digitally enabled organisation to improve clinical quality, patient & staff experience, operational effectiveness & driving research, and innovation through the introduction of Hive; our Electronic Patient Record system which launched in September 2022.We’re proud to be a major academic Research Centre & Education provider, providing you with a robust infrastructure to encourage and facilitate high-quality research programmes.
